Got 9 rods in at Mich City this am at break of dawn. Had one hit on a rigger in 2.5 hours. Coulda been a drum...who knows. The run, we know, for most part is over, but nice day and willing bodies, wth...
However, think we fished the wrong program. Some of the shore (night time guys) did well. They said fish were moving thru at night but soon as sun started to peak her nose up, they disappeared. Interesting!!

I also heard shore guys railed them in the dark. And there's a lot in the creek. The creek/harbor is now colder than the lake, so that sucks the fish out of the lake into the harbor
